New Jersey Statutes, Title: 17, CORPORATIONS AND INSTITUTIONS FOR FINANCE AND INSURANCE

    Chapter 22e:

      Section: 17:22e-16: Adequacy of loss reserves

           16. If a reinsurance intermediary-manager establishes loss reserves, the reinsurer shall annually, or more frequently at the commissioner's discretion, obtain the opinion of an actuary attesting to the adequacy of loss reserves established for losses incurred and outstanding on business produced by the reinsurance intermediary-manager. The loss reserve opinion shall be in the format and otherwise satisfy all requirements established by the commissioner for loss reserve opinions required to be submitted by licensed insurers in this State. This opinion shall be in addition to any other loss reserve certification required in this State.

L.1993,c.244,s.16.
